Smart 3D Cameras Market Overview
The smart 3D camera has dozens of functions such as face recognition, gesture recognition, human skeleton recognition, 3D measurement, environment perception, 3D map reconstruction, etc. It can be widely used in television, mobile phones, robots, drones, logistics, VR / AR, smart home security, automotive driving assistance, and other fields.

Smart 3D Cameras Market Analysis:
The global Smart 3D Cameras Market size was estimated at USD 1837 million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 3423.34 million by 2030, exhibiting a CAGR of 9.30% during the forecast period.
North America Smart 3D Cameras market size was USD 478.67 million in 2023, at a CAGR of 7.97% during the forecast period of 2025 through 2030.

Smart 3D Cameras Key Market Trends :
- Integration with AI and IoT
Smart 3D cameras are increasingly integrated with AI and IoT, enhancing automation in security, automotive, and consumer electronics. - Rising Adoption in Automotive and Robotics
The automotive industry is leveraging smart 3D cameras for autonomous driving and driver-assist features, while robotics benefits from improved perception and navigation. - Growth in AR/VR Applications
The demand for immersive experiences in gaming, training, and healthcare is driving the adoption of smart 3D cameras in AR/VR devices. - Advancements in Time-of-Flight (ToF) Technology
ToF-based 3D cameras are gaining traction due to their high precision and application in smartphones, security, and industrial automation. - Expansion in Smart Home Security
Smart 3D cameras are widely used in smart home security systems, offering facial recognition and motion detection for enhanced protection.

Market Drivers
- Growing Demand for 3D Imaging in Consumer Electronics
Increasing adoption of 3D cameras in smartphones, laptops, and VR/AR devices is fueling market growth. - Advancements in AI and Machine Learning
AI-driven 3D image analysis is boosting applications in automation, healthcare, and security industries. - Increased Investment in Automotive and Robotics
Automakers and robotics firms are integrating 3D cameras for automation, safety, and improved operational efficiency.
Market Restraints
- High Cost of Smart 3D Camera Technology
Advanced 3D cameras require expensive components, making them less affordable for small businesses and consumers. - Technical Challenges in Accuracy and Calibration
Issues like image distortion, accuracy in low-light conditions, and complex calibration processes can hinder adoption. - Privacy and Security Concerns
The use of 3D cameras in surveillance and facial recognition raises ethical and regulatory concerns.
Market Opportunities
- Growing AR/VR and Gaming Industry
The expanding virtual and augmented reality market presents significant opportunities for smart 3D camera adoption. - Rising Demand in Healthcare and Medical Imaging
3D cameras are being increasingly used for advanced diagnostics, surgeries, and rehabilitation treatments. - Smart City and Security Applications
Governments worldwide are investing in smart surveillance and security systems, creating a favorable market environment.
Market Challenges
- Complexity in Integration with Existing Systems
Many industries face difficulties in integrating 3D camera technology with their current infrastructure. - Limited Awareness in Emerging Markets
Developing regions have lower adoption due to a lack of awareness and high initial investment. - Competition from Alternative Imaging Technologies
Traditional cameras, LiDAR, and other imaging solutions pose competitive challenges to 3D cameras.
